Transaction d100794026ee71e3a32b20fe135d305eb688df5d12ec33e51e2485d194e5245b
1 Input
1 Output
-
d100794026ee71e3a32b20fe135d305eb688df5d12ec33e51e2485d194e5245b:0
- value
- 68363
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b035e6a3c7a165247b060b9ea63c45de159df34 OP_EQUAL
- address
- 3753pvw2P7UNm3Sdxmasivy8WEbA4LMecs